Output 221c241208de589180d2a85e9155318adf77e5296b660c39d77d128b534c74c6:0

value
1038645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aba86744e6417bef16031a6ccd4495ea39cf771 OP_EQUAL
address
32fk8Th5J2MRARah6Vk9nPLNHqEvQECvT8
transaction
221c241208de589180d2a85e9155318adf77e5296b660c39d77d128b534c74c6
spent
true